    Bulgogi/teriyaki house with some nice options for quick lunch. For is prepared within a decent time. Comes with side of lettuce onion and sauce (spicy mayo/spicy korean). The chicken and bulgogi beef were really delicious, not over cooked. Served on top of rice. There are street parkings right in front of the store. Few booths available to dine in.

    I ordered delivery through Uber eats for a Saturday lunch The portions are good to fill you up for sure. My tastebuds were happy with the bibimbap and the beef bulgogi & spicy pork bowl. The veggies for the bibimbap were great quality and fresh. Side of Fried rice has the regular fried rice flavor, a bit salty, but still pretty good. Not bad at all. Can't really say anything bad about the food. The flavor and quality was there for sure. Other than the fried rice and dumplings being "average" (for my taste buds). But again, I have no complaints really. 5 stars.

So I just didn't feel like cooking and had a taste for Asian food and found this place. The food was decent, worthy of going back, I guess. Of course it was freshly prepared and hot when I picked it up. However this didn't really taste like Korean food that I have tasted before. Very BASIC and underwhelming. I ordered the pork bulgogi bowl and was not impressed. It was just OK. The shrimp teriyaki was so incredibly SALTY and inedible. But the soy garlic wings were very good and fried hard just like I like my wings. Cucumber kimchi was delicious. All in all, hey, it fed us and made us full but not really satisfied. I would return, but not going out of my way for this.
